Experience New Zealand's most iconic attractions while travelling in Premium Economy Comfort in a mid-size group. Key highlights in the South Island include a cruise on breathtaking Milford Sound and a spectacular rail journey on the world-renowned TranzAlpine. In the North Island, you'll sail through the beautiful Bay of Islands to the famous Hole in the Rock. Enjoy two-night stays in the popular cities of Queenstown, Wellington, Rotorua and the Bay of Islands.

Day 2: Christchurch - Mt Cook - Twizel

Following an introductory city sights tour, depart from Christchurch and journey through the southern Canterbury Plains, heading towards the stunning Lake Tekapo.

Day 3: Twizel - Dunedin

Depart Twizel and visit the beautiful Lake Benmore. Follow the Waitaki River to Oamaru, famous for its limestone. Continue south to Dunedin and enjoy a city sights tour followed by some free time.

Day 11: Wellington - Taupo - Rotorua

Depart Wellington and view the snowcapped peaks of Mt Ruapehu and Mt Tongariro as you travel to Lake Taupo. Visit the spectacular Huka Falls then travel along the Thermal Explorer Highway to the geothermal wonderland of Rotorua.

Day 13: Rotorua - Bay of Islands

This morning depart Rotorua and travel north to Whangarei to the Bay of Islands. This afternoon enjoy a guided tour of the Waitangi Treaty Grounds, the location of the signing of the treaty between the Māori tribes and the British.

Day 14: Bay of Islands

Today you will cruise through the beautiful Bay of Islands aboard a luxury catamaran to Cape Brett, where a historic lighthouse keeps watch over Piercy Island, or as it is popularly known, the ‘Hole in the Rock’.
